Welcome to The Chopping Block – where crypto insiders Haseeb Qureshi, Tom Schmidt, Tarun Chitra, and Robert Leshner chop it up about the latest news. This week, after an incredibly eventful year for crypto, The Chopping Block crew makes its picks for the best and worst of 2023, including its biggest winners and losers, biggest surprises, best memes, best or worst pivots, biggest flops, best comeback stories, favorite podcast guests and predictions for 2024. Hear why some in the gang consider Solana to be the year’s biggest winner, Circle the biggest loser, MicroStrategy the best and worst pivot, Coinbase the best comeback and a renewed boom in crypto lending one of the top predictions for 2024.
